Aprender Python no termina cuando el código funciona. El verdadero reto aparece al manejar información real, ordenar datos y estructurar programas que crezcan sin volverse caóticos. Ahí entran las estructuras de datos de python.
Este curso está pensado para dar ese siguiente paso lógico. Ayuda a entender cómo almacenar, organizar y manipular datos de forma eficiente, incluso si nunca se ha trabajado con programación avanzada.

Comprender y usar estructuras de datos en Python
El contenido explica qué son las estructuras de datos y por qué resultan esenciales al programar. Se estudian cadenas, listas, diccionarios y tuplas como herramientas prácticas, no como conceptos abstractos.
Cada estructura se presenta con ejemplos claros. Las listas permiten agrupar información. Los diccionarios almacenan datos en pares clave y valor. Las tuplas ayudan a manejar conjuntos ordenados de forma segura.
También se aprende a leer y escribir archivos. Este punto resulta clave para trabajar con datos externos, automatizar tareas y procesar información sin hacerlo todo manualmente.
El nivel es principiante. No se exige experiencia previa, aunque resulta ideal para quienes ya conocen lo básico de Python y desean avanzar con más criterio.
No está orientado a personas que buscan interfaces gráficas o desarrollo web inmediato. El foco se mantiene en la lógica y el manejo de datos.
Tambien lee:
Qué se logra al finalizar el curso
Tras 19 horas de estudio, será posible crear programas más estructurados y fáciles de mantener. Se gana claridad al ordenar información, recorrer datos y aplicar procesos de varios pasos.
El curso prepara para análisis de datos más complejos y para continuar con aprendizajes posteriores en ciencia de datos o automatización.
Se imparte en español mediante doblaje por IA, lo que facilita el seguimiento desde cualquier nivel inicial. La gran cantidad de estudiantes refleja su utilidad práctica.
El curso fue creado por la Universidad de Michigan y se ofrece de forma gratuita en Coursera como recurso formativo estructurado.
Para quien desea dejar atrás scripts simples y empezar a pensar como programador, este curso marca una transición clara y bien guiada.







